Biografía:

Importante cantante y compositor de bonitas melodías folk, su primer sencillo “Taxi” logró un éxito inminente, pero sus primeros dos álbumes, “Head And Trais” y “Sniper And Other Love Songs” no disfrutarían del mismo éxito. Su tercer trabajo, “Short Stories”, permaneció en las listas unos seis meses gracias al sencillo “W.O.L.D.”. El disco “Verities And Balderdash” fue disco de oro y Chapin también consigue una nominación de la Academia por su documental “Legendary Champions” en 1968.
